West Brom sign defender Phillips from Liverpool
Briefly

West Bromwich Albion has officially signed defender Nat Phillips from Liverpool on a three-year contract for an undisclosed fee. The 28-year-old center-back, who made only 19 Premier League appearances for Liverpool, brings extensive experience in the Championship, having helped Derby County avoid relegation last season and previously playing for Bournemouth and Cardiff City. Sporting director Andrew Nestor praised Phillips' leadership qualities and expressed confidence that he will further develop while contributing to the team’s ambitions of promotion to the Premier League. Phillips also voiced his commitment to the club’s goals and building connections with supporters.
